UK News: Third man held over Omagh police murder

Police have arrested a third man in connection with the murder of Constable Ronan Kerr in Omagh, County Tyrone.

The 33-year-old man was arrested in the Omagh area. Police have been given an extra five days to question two other men over the murder of Constable Kerr, who was killed by a car bomb last Saturday.

Farewell to trucking chief

The funeral of trucking chief Edward Stobart was taking place today.

The service for Mr Stobart, who transformed his father's firm, Eddie Stobart, into a nationwide haulage giant, will be held at Carlisle Cathedral. Three of the famous green and red Eddie Stobart trucks will head the funeral convoy.

Peel projects an interest in famous studios group

Pinewood Shepperton has received an 87.8-million takeover bid from a company run by billionaire investor John Whittaker.

Peel Holdings, which recently sold the Trafford Centre to Capital Shopping Centres for 1.6 billion, has offered 190p per share for the business.

Pinewood, home to the Harry Potter and James Bond films, has studios in Pinewood in Buckinghamshire, and Shepperton and Teddington in Middlesex. Peel has built a 29.78 per cent stake in Pinewood.

Firefox author dies

Thriller writer Craig Thomas has died at the age of 69. The Cardiff-born author was best-known for his book Firefox, made into a Hollywood blockbuster starring Clint Eastwood as a US fighter pilot.

Thomas's novels were considered "meticulously" researched, with "cutting-edge technology" which made him an international bestseller, according to friends.

Stars' role call for arts policy

SIR Patrick Stewart has joined other stars who have signed and delivered a petition to Downing Street calling for a "coherent" arts policy.

More than 200 arts groups lost out on Arts Council funding. The petition asks for an "arts summit" to give the industry a clear direction.

Blackpool: A three-year-old boy was found drinking from a can of lager while his parents were at the pub. He was one of five youngsters living amid "shocking" conditions in a house in Blackpool. Angela Freer, 31, and Christopher Steele, 55, were given suspended sentences at Preston Crown Court after admitting neglect.

London: A man has been jailed for four and a half years for stealing a 1.2-million Stradivarius violin at Euston station. John Michael Maughan, 30, of no fixed address, took the instrument from Korean-born musician, Min-Jin Kym.
